看板Linux
标 题Re: [问题] 能直接将硬碟改成RAID1吗?
发信站SayYA 资讯站 (Tue May 20 23:21:03 2008)
转信站ptt!ctu-reader!ctu-peer!news.nctu!News.Math.NCTU!SayYa
※ 引述《[email protected] (我对不起story板)》之铭言:
> ※ 引述《[email protected] (小州)》之铭言:
> : 做 raid 都会破坏原本资料, 更何况你的 sda 已经使用中无法进行。
> NO 非也非也
> 做RAID不一定会破坏原本资料 着麽改到可以用才是重点 (超级麻烦!!!)
嗯... RAID1 基本上想想是可行的,不过其他 RAID 似乎就不大可能,尤其
RAID 0 就不可能了。
> 至少software RAID 有办法做到不破坏原本资料
不过您後续似乎都没给答案,令人摸不到头续的感觉?
基本上一般使用是:
mdadm --create /dev/md0 --level=1 --raid-disks=2 missing /dev/sda1
sda1 就是现有有放资料的分割区,後续再:
mdadm --add /dev/md0 /dev/sdb1
这样就是把 sdb1 这个新的分割区空间放进去。
这个方式在 raid1 上面可以玩,但是 raid0 与 raid5 这类就会有问题了。
最後其实还要改 /etc/fstab, /boot/grub/menu.lst 档案,尤其若是改的是
/ 分割区更是要注意。最後得使用 mkinitrd 等工具重作 initrd image,
尤其 swap 与 / 的位置都改过的情况一下,如此开机初始化载入处理才不会
找不到实际的 raid device.
--
--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- --
现代人普遍的现象: 「小学而大遗」、「舍本而逐末」
「以偏而概全」、「因噎而废食」
--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- -- --
--
※ Origin: SayYA 资讯站 <bbs.sayya.org>
◆ From: kendlee.sayya.org